Export variants were used in South America Mauser in Germany made Model 1933 and Model 1934 rifles for Ethiopia too; the former with the Mauser banner on the receiver ring and the Lion of Judah on the side, and the latter marked with Ethiopia’s national crest like the FN rifles. It’s based on the Gewehr 98 Action, the 98 B, and effectively, it’s a pre-World War II version of a K-98. About: Mauser Standardmodell The Standardmodell rifle (also known as Mauser Model 1924 or Mauser Model 1933) is a bolt-action rifle designed to chamber the 7. The rifle was developed in 1924 but entered full-scale production in 1933.
